它以开源、高性能、易用性等特点,赢得了众多开发者和企业的青睐
然而,在安装MySQL的过程中,有时会遇到“安装类型选择没有”的情况,这无疑给初学者和一些经验不足的用户带来了困扰
本文将深入探讨这一问题,分析其产生的原因,并提供一系列切实可行的解决方案
一、问题背景 MySQL的安装过程通常包括多个步骤,其中选择安装类型是一个关键环节
安装类型可能包括“典型安装”、“自定义安装”、“完全安装”等,用户可以根据自己的需求选择合适的安装方案
然而,在某些情况下,用户可能会发现安装界面中并没有提供这些选项,或者选项呈现为灰色不可选状态
二、问题分析 2.1 安装包问题 首先,安装包本身可能存在问题
例如,下载的安装包可能不完整或已损坏,导致安装程序无法正确显示所有选项
此外,如果安装包是针对特定操作系统或硬件平台定制的,那么在其他环境下安装时也可能出现选项缺失的情况
2.2 系统兼容性 系统兼容性是另一个可能导致安装类型选择缺失的重要因素
不同的操作系统版本、硬件配置以及已安装的软件环境都可能影响MySQL的安装过程
例如,某些较旧的操作系统版本可能不支持MySQL的最新安装包,导致安装过程中出现异常
2.3 用户权限 在安装MySQL时,用户需要具备相应的系统权限
如果当前用户权限不足,安装程序可能会限制某些选项的显示
例如,在没有管理员权限的情况下尝试安装MySQL,可能会导致安装类型选择等关键选项被隐藏或禁用
2.4 安装程序错误 安装程序本身可能存在bug或设计缺陷,导致在某些情况下无法正确显示安装类型选项
这种情况通常与安装程序的版本有关,新版本中可能已经修复了旧版本中的bug
三、解决方案 针对上述可能的原因,我们可以采取以下措施来解决MySQL安装类型选择缺失的问题: 3.1 检查安装包 首先,确保下载的安装包是完整且未损坏的
可以从MySQL官方网站或其他可靠的下载源重新下载安装包,并验证其完整性
如果安装包是压缩文件,可以使用压缩工具检查其完整性;如果安装包是安装程序,可以尝试重新下载并运行安装程序以验证其是否完整
3.2 检查系统兼容性 在安装MySQL之前,务必确认当前操作系统版本、硬件配置以及已安装的软件环境与MySQL安装包的兼容性
可以查阅MySQL官方文档或社区论坛中的相关信息,了解MySQL在不同操作系统和硬件平台上的安装要求和限制
如果当前系统环境不满足MySQL的安装要求,可以考虑升级操作系统、更换硬件或卸载不兼容的软件
3.3 提升用户权限 确保当前用户具备安装MySQL所需的系统权限
如果当前用户权限不足,可以尝试以管理员身份运行安装程序
在Windows系统中,可以右击安装程序并选择“以管理员身份运行”;在Linux或Mac OS系统中,可以使用`sudo`命令来运行安装程序
3.4 更新或修复安装程序 如果怀疑安装程序本身存在问题,可以尝试更新到最新版本的安装程序
MySQL官方会定期发布更新版本以修复已知的问题和改进安装过程
此外,也可以尝试使用安装程序的修复功能来修复可能存在的损坏或错误
3.5 手动配置安装选项 如果安装界面中没有提供安装类型选项,可以尝试手动配置安装选项
这通常涉及在安装过程中选择自定义安装路径、组件和服务等
虽然这种方法可能比较繁琐,但它提供了更高的灵活性和可控性
在安装过程中,仔细阅读每个步骤的提示信息,并根据自己的需求进行配置
3.6寻求社区帮助 如果以上方法都无法解决问题,可以考虑向MySQL社区或相关论坛寻求帮助
在发帖时,尽量提供详细的系统信息、安装包版本以及安装过程中遇到的错误信息
社区中的其他用户或专家可能会提供有用的建议或解决方案
四、预防措施 为了避免MySQL安装类型选择缺失的问题再次发生,我们可以采取以下预防措施: 4.1 定期更新系统 保持操作系统和已安装软件的最新版本是避免兼容性问题的关键
定期更新系统可以确保您的环境能够支持最新版本的MySQL安装包
4.2 下载官方安装包 始终从MySQL官方网站或其他可靠的下载源获取安装包
避免使用来源不明的安装包,以免遇到损坏、不完整或包含恶意软件的风险
4.3备份重要数据 在安装MySQL之前,务必备份重要数据
这可以防止在安装过程中因意外情况导致数据丢失或损坏
4.4仔细阅读文档 在安装MySQL之前,仔细阅读官方文档或相关教程
这可以帮助您了解安装过程中的关键步骤和注意事项,从而提高安装成功率
五、结论 MySQL安装类型选择缺失是一个常见但可解决的问题
通过检查安装包、系统兼容性、用户权限以及安装程序本身等方面,我们可以找到问题的根源并采取相应的解决方案
此外,采取一些预防措施可以降低未来遇到类似问题的风险
希望本文能够为您提供有用的信息和指导,帮助您顺利安装MySQL并享受其带来的便利和高效